On Shore Technology Inc. OSTTS17715A

OSTTS17715A On Shore Technology Inc.
On Shore Technology Inc.TERM BLOCK PLUG 17POS 90DEG 5MM

Inquiry Now!

Part Number*
Quantity*
Contact Name*
Email*
Company Name*
Country*
Comments*